I'm not sure the buy a month worked for me. I kept getting a message that said "you have already bought two continuing months" which was false, and it wouldn't let me buy one. So I just bought 200 point days in August and September to keep my status. I had some serious issues getting the days purchased. The FT store kept telling me that the 200 point days page was broken (while every other page in the FT store worked fine), but refreshing constantly eventually got it to work. I would estimate that it took me over an hour of refreshing the page to buy 3 200 point days last month.
Since that has happened both times i have tried to use the FT store to buy 200 point days, I am reasonably confident that it is intentional, and FT wants you to give up buying days and thereby lose your Iron Man status when you realize at the last minute you need to buy a day or two.
The other scam I encountered is on the confirmation page. After attempting to buy a 200 point day, instead of getting a page saying "your purchase was successful," I got an error page that said "this page is down, please try back later." But the purchase had gone through. Unfortunately, this gimmick tricked me into buying an unnecessary day. So check your Iron Man page after every attempt to buy a day, regardless of whether you think the purchase succeeded or not.
